After months of anticipation, Men’s Basketball at Embry-Riddle Aeronautical University’s Prescott Campus tips off for the first time on Saturday, Oct. 31, at 2 p.m. vs. Biola University at the campus’ newly renovated Athletic Center.
“This is a community that shows a lot of support for athletic programs of all ages, but I think they’ve been craving college basketball,” said Men’s Basketball Head Coach Eric Fundalewicz. “The team has been working incredibly hard and is excited to get out on the court and represent Embry-Riddle and the Quad-City communities.”
Before the game, from 12:30 to 2 p.m., the community is invited to “Trunk or Treat” by parking and decorating their cars in Parking Lot “S” adjacent to the soccer field on Dobberteen Drive, then distributing candy to children from the trunks or backs of their vehicles. The parking lot will be closed during the event to provide a safe family environment for the trick-or-treaters.
A costume contest will be held during the game’s halftime.
